What is the difference between low-tack adhesive, repositionable adhesive and rem

Yes, we hear you. They all sound the same don't they?
I will start with the Low-Tack Adhesive - it is as described a very weak adhesive - almost like a static cling or a posted note. Typical use - appliance store wants to plaster their special all over the place - even right on the appliances. No problem with this Low-Tack adhesive. After the special is over or the appliance is sold, the decal will be very easy to remove. Mainly indoor use.
The Removable Adhesive - it is an all weather resistant adhesive that will cure slowly - over 3 to 4 months approx. after which it will become permanent. So it is often used for bumper decals - election campaign or some time limited event. After your candidate lost the election, you will want to remove the decal ...  :-)
The Repositionable Adhesive - is an all purpose adhesive - that is very slow curing. This allows you to not only remove it easily, but to reposition it. If you applied the decal crooked, you will be able to remove it and replace or reposition it. The decal will also be readily removed many months later.
